Self-powered sensors acting as the eyes or ears of the field of Industry 4.0

But, these events can also bring forth new energy. Look at manufacturing. The digitization process continues to increase in speed so that it can become more efficient in energy use, sustainable and adaptable (and consequently more resilient to crisis). In Industry 4.0 sensors serve as eyes and ears to various applications. They can detect motor vibrations as well as monitor the climate of the room and decrease the chance of downtime in production through pre-planned maintenance. Experts forecast annual growth rates that exceed 20 percent for the use of wireless sensors. In the most recent issue the client magazine Perpetuum companies like Comepi, Pressac, Rutronik and Siemens provide insights on how they use auto-powered EnOcean sensors to achieve their Industry 4.0 initiatives. Wireless sensors generate the required power through using energy to harvest. They get energy from the environment and utilize light, temperature and motion as sources of power which means that no batteries, cables or replacements are required.

The new workplace models are based on the use of smart spaces

Self-powered EnOcean technology is rapidly becoming a reality in other fields too. in HR, particularly at the level of managing director, as well as in facilities management firms and facility management companies, decision makers are creating innovative workplace strategies that work and flexible office setups that allow employees to safely return to work. Sensor-based IoT solutions offer the data needed to analyze and optimize the efficiency of buildings, and also enable smart spaces. Based on this technology firms can develop flexible desk sharing plans to allow for a mixture of work at work and at home. Companies such as T-Systems, Schweickert or Aruba demonstrate in detail cases how smart spaces operate in real life.

Technology isn’t going to solve all the problems we face but it has already contributed in many areas towards shaping the future of sustainability. Energy harvesting is only one of the pieces but it is a proven method to conserve energy for buildings or industry 4.0.
